    Hi moms! Thanks for all your help! I am coming to WDW in August next year with a VERY fussy eater (my mother). Is there any way we could order kids entrees for her (they seem more her thing) at table service and pay with her adult dining plan token?

    Hi Lizzie, 

    Welcome back to the Disney Parks Moms Panel and thank you for asking us another question!

    The short answer to your question is, yes, you can use an adult’s Disney Dining Plan entitlements in order to order off the Kids’ Menu at any Walt Disney World Resort table service restaurant

    The long answer, however, is that I’m not sure that you’ll want to do that because it means that your Mother really won’t be getting her money’s worth when it comes to the Disney Dining Plan. I’ve travelled to Walt Disney World Resort on several occasions with picky adult eaters, some of whom were even pickier than my toddler when it comes to food. I was seriously blown away by how great all of the restaurants were at accommodating Guests’ preferences when it comes to food. You’d be surprised at how many things can be prepared more “plainly” or with simpler sauces and ingredients. My suggestion, therefore, is to see first whether there is anything on the adult menu that can be modified to suit your Mother’s tastes, and use the kids’ menu as a backup if there really is nothing that strikes her fancy that day.
